摘 要:目的:观察长时间递增负荷运动后以及营养干预对大鼠红细胞老化的影响,试图探讨运动性贫血的发生机制以及相关的防治方法。方法:本实验在大鼠运动性贫血模型的基础上,选取唾液酸(SA)、丝氨酸磷脂(PS)外翻率的测定,并结合激光共聚焦技术研究红细胞的老化。结果:运动性贫血时大鼠红细胞唾液酸(SA)较对照组明显降低(P<0.05),丝氨酸磷脂(PS)外翻率较对照组明显增加(P<0.01);抗运动性贫血剂能明显提高大鼠红细胞唾液酸(SA)的含量(P<0.05),并显著降低(PS)外翻率(P<0.05)。结论:运动性贫血大鼠红细胞老化增加,抗运动性贫血剂通过降低自由基的生成,有效减少红细胞的老化,改善红细胞损伤来治疗运动性贫血。Studying the effect of progressive overload exercise and nutrition intervention on ageing effect of red cell of rats, thus to explore the mechanism of sports anemia and to find effective methods in the prevention and treatment of sports anemia. Methods: based on the sports anemia rats model, this part of the research investigated the level of SA and PS of red blood cell combined with the laser scanning confocal microscope technology. Results: it was found that such training and sports anemia caused a decrease of Ery - SA and an increase of PS( P 〈 0.05, P 〈 0.01 ). Anemia countermeasures raised the levels of Ery - SA and decreased the level of PS(P〈0.05). Conclusion:sports anemia increased the senility of RBC, and the oxidative stress levels were lowered by the anemia countermeasures, and senility of red blood cells was reduced, thus to help the treatment of sports anemia.
